I’ve had wide range of experiences about internet connection at the hotels. With luxury hotels and big names I experienced terrible internet access, while some small 2-star hotels surprisingly the best. Overall it’s okay but if your room is away from the router, at the corner of the building or the hotel is overcrowded with the guests then the connection speed goes down. I would go with short term home rental or airbnb etc. with fiber internet connection. Van also is a relatively big city I’m sure there are Airbnb’s with speedy internet.

Kayseri is probably somewhere between 10-15th developed city in Turkiye. It has great food, history and one of best ski mountain. Also very close to one of the most famous touristic attractions in Turkiye - Capadoccia. As many people already said it’s obviously very conservative and I don’t think locals are used to foreigners much, maybe except the area surrounding the university campus however Erciyes University is definitely above average when compared to other universities in Turkiye. Also, winters are usually cold in the city. You will be fine during the day but not sure when it’s dark. In sum, I don’t really recommend Kayseri for an Erasmus student. I will suggest Istanbul and Ankara as top tiers for foreign students.
